### Slimming Plugin Images

Keep your Quillbox plugin images lean: build from the `quillbase-slim` parent, strip build tools in a final stage, and skip bundling test fixtures. Run `qb-lint --image` before publishing — it flags anything over 200MB. The lint results get recorded in the plugin registry database, which you can reach with the connection string below.

replica DSN, kajep-yahag: mssql://praok_svc:iF@db-8d68.plorvaio.local:5432/eliion

## Tile Cache Layer

The Mapwright renderer caches rasterized tiles in a bounded in-memory store before falling back to the Quarrystone object store. Eviction is LRU with a hard byte ceiling; no tile data is written to disk, which limits exposure if a host is compromised. Cache keys include the style hash to prevent cross-tenant leakage. The tuning constants below govern size and eviction cadence.

tuning table, yajog-yahof:
BUDGETS = {
    "lamvan": 303,
    "wenox": 460,
    "fenvan": 525,
}

### Runbook: Orphan Sweeper (Pellux Platform)

The orphaned-resource sweeper runs nightly and deletes volumes, snapshots, and load balancers with no owning deployment tag. Before a release cut, confirm SWEEPER_DRY_RUN=true in staging so the release manager can review the candidate list. Production flips to false only after sign-off. The sweeper reads its configuration from `/etc/pellux/sweeper.env`, including region scope and retention window. Its API credential for the resource catalog is set on the following line.

env line for fafof-fahag: LEDGER_TOKEN5=f8790